Abstract

The utility model discloses a specimen clamping forceps for laparoscopic surgery of obstetrics and gynecology department, which belongs to the technical field of gynecological equipment, and comprises a forceps body provided with a negative pressure pipe, wherein one end of the forceps body is fixedly connected with a fixed forceps, one end of the forceps body is hinged with a movable forceps, one side of the fixed forceps, which is opposite to the movable forceps, is provided with a storage groove, two sides of the inner wall of the storage groove are respectively provided with a baffle in a sliding way, the bottoms of the two baffles are welded with a connecting plate, and the fixed forceps and the movable forceps are respectively provided with a mounting groove; the utility model discloses can obtain collecting the tiny particle of bulky sample after the breakage, avoid tiny particle to drop and put thing groove outside, reduce the amount of labour that medical staff performed the operation, reduce consuming time of operation simultaneously, avoid the tiny particle risk of clearing up not completely, can adjust according to the volume of sample, fixed more stable when making the sample clamp get, can't be got by the clamp when having avoided the sample volume undersize simultaneously, facilitate the use.

Background
The laparoscopic surgery is widely applied in the gynecological field, has fewer incisions compared with the traditional surgery, represents the development direction of minimally invasive surgery, is not perfect in the prior laparoscopic instruments, and is a main obstacle for hindering the development of the laparoscope. Most tumors are easy to take out after being packed in the specimen bag because the tissue is soft or brittle.
In the prior patent (publication number: CN 210962212U), a specimen clamping forceps for laparoscopic surgery of obstetrics and gynecology department comprises a forceps head, a forceps body and a forceps tail which are connected in sequence, wherein a handle for controlling the forceps head is arranged on the forceps tail; the clamp head comprises a fixed clamp and a movable clamp, a row of crushing teeth are arranged at the end parts of the fixed clamp and the movable clamp, and material placing areas are arranged on the fixed clamp and the movable clamp; the inside negative pressure pipe that is equipped with of fixed pincers, pincers body and pincers tail, negative pressure pipe one end is fixed and is put the thing district inner wall at fixed pincers, and the other end outwards extends by the tail end of pincers tail, and fixed pincers put and are equipped with a plurality of negative pressure suction holes that link to each other with the negative pressure pipe on the thing district lateral wall.
In implementing the present invention, the inventor finds that at least the following problems exist in the prior art and are not solved: 1. two rows of garrulous teeth press from both sides tiny granule in garrulous back with the bold object and can scatter, have increased medical staff's the amount of labour, have prolonged operation time simultaneously, 2, can't put the size in district according to the size adjustment of object, lead to less object probably the centre gripping stable inadequately, consequently, need a gynaecology and obstetrics laparoscopic surgery's sample clamp to get pincers and solve above problem.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ide a pincers are got to specimen clamp of gynaecology and obstetrics's laparoscopic surgery to solve the problem of proposing among the above-mentioned background art.
In order to achieve the above object, the utility model provides a following technical scheme: a specimen clamping forceps for laparoscopic surgery of obstetrics and gynecology department comprises a forceps body provided with a negative pressure pipe, one end of the forceps body is fixedly connected with a fixed forceps, one end of the forceps body is hinged with a movable forceps, one side of the fixed forceps, which is opposite to the movable forceps, is provided with a storage groove, two sides of the inner wall of the storage groove are respectively provided with a baffle in a sliding way, the bottoms of the two baffles are welded with a connecting plate, the fixed forceps and the movable forceps are respectively provided with a mounting groove, a vertically arranged guide groove is mounted in the mounting groove, a vertically arranged rack is slidably mounted in the guide groove, the top end of the rack is fixedly connected with the connecting plate, a motor is mounted in the mounting groove, the top end of an output shaft of the motor is welded with a gear, a clamping plate is slidably mounted in the storage groove, the bottom of the clamping plate is welded with a support pillar, the bottom of the support pillar is fixedly connected with an air suction pipe, a horizontally arranged crossbeam is slidably mounted in the mounting groove, and the top of the crossbeam is fixedly connected with the bottom of the support pillar, two cylinders are installed at the bottom in the installation groove, and piston rods of the cylinders are fixedly connected with the bottom of the cross beam.
Further, the sliding grooves are formed in the two sides of the inner wall of the storage groove, the baffle is slidably mounted in the sliding grooves, the sliding grooves are communicated with the mounting groove, and the baffle can be conveniently retracted into the mounting groove when not used.
Further, splint are for being equipped with the arc structure of cavity, and the array has the round hole on the splint roof, and the round hole is linked together with the cavity, and the convenience adsorbs fixedly to the sample.
Further, be equipped with circular through-hole in the pillar, the through-hole is linked together with the cavity in the splint, and, the one end of breathing pipe runs through crossbeam and through-hole fixed connection, can adsorb the sample through the round hole on the splint, and is more firm to the fixed of sample.
Further, the splint are located between the two baffles, the baffles are matched with the storage groove, and the small particles of the large-size specimen after being crushed are collected.
Compared with the prior art, the beneficial effects of the utility model are that:
through structures such as baffle, splint, round hole, breathing pipe, pillar, motor, can obtain collecting the tiny particle of bulky sample after the breakage, avoid tiny particle to drop to put the thing groove outside, reduced the amount of labour of medical staff's operation, reduced consuming time of operation simultaneously, avoided the tiny particle risk of clearing up not completely.
Through cylinder, crossbeam, pillar, splint, connecting plate, rack and gear isotructure, can adjust according to the volume of sample, fixed more stable when making the sample clamp get, can't be got by the clamp when having avoided the sample volume undersize simultaneously, it is consuming time to have reduced the operation, facilitates the use.

The top of the beam 16 is fixedly connected with the bottom end of the pillar 14, two cylinders 17 are mounted at the bottom of the mounting groove 7, and piston rods of the cylinders 17 are fixedly connected with the bottom of the beam 16.
When in use, the air suction pipe 15 is connected to the negative pressure pipe in the clamp body 1, then the fixed clamp 2 and the movable clamp 3 are moved to the position of a specimen, the specimen is placed between the two article placing grooves 4, then the specimen is clamped by the movable clamp 3, if the volume of the specimen is too small, four air cylinders 17 arranged in the installation grooves 7 in the fixed clamp 2 and the movable clamp 3 can be opened, a supporting column 14 is pushed upwards by a pushing beam 16 of a piston rod of the air cylinder 17, a clamping plate 12 is pushed upwards by the supporting column 14 so as to clamp the specimen, meanwhile, due to the action of the air suction pipe 15 connected with the negative pressure pipe, the specimen is fixed more stably by a round hole 13 at the top of the clamping plate 12, if the volume of the specimen is too large, the motor 10 in the installation groove 7 can be opened, the gear 11 is rotated by the rotation of an output shaft of the motor 10, the gear 11 drives the engaged rack 9 to move upwards in the guide groove 8, through the removal of rack 9, upwards promote the connecting plate 18 at rack 9 top to two baffles 6 that make connecting plate 18 top begin the rebound, then rethread splint 12 rebound, carry out the breakage to the sample, simultaneously because the effect of baffle 6, the tiny granule that has the scattering when avoiding broken drops and puts thing groove 4 outsidely, and in general, this operation clamp is got pincers and is more convenient when medical staff uses.
